Celebrity spa owner agrees to plea deal

BEVERLY HILLS, Calif.

Maria Hashemipour, 51, will plead guilty to one count of access device fraud. The 40 other counts against her will be dropped.

Prosecutors allege she used credit card information from celebrity clients to ring up bogus charges. She could face up to 10 years in prison and fines up to $250,000, and be forced to pay her clients back. She could also be deported as part of her plea deal with prosecutors.
